Proposal of Comprehensive Model of Teaching Basic Nursing Skills Under Goal-Based Scenario Theory
Yuri Sannomiya1, Yoko Muranaka2, Misako Teraoka1
1Juntendo University Faculty of Health Care and Nursing.
Abstract:
The purpose of this study is to design and develop a comprehensive model of teaching basic nursing skills on GBS theory and Four-Stage Performance Cycle. We designed a basic nursing skill program that consists of three courses: basic, application and multi-tasking. The program will be offered as blended study, utilizing e-learning.

Nursing Implementation
The five steps to implementing effective nursing care include reassessing the patient, reviewing and revising the existing nursing care plan, organizing the resources and care delivery, anticipating and preventing complications, and implementing nursing interventions.
